    There are A LOT of choices if you want to workout outside of the home. A few of the bigger things…read moreto consider will always be time and money. My old gym membership had expired and it was time for me to figure out what I wanted to do next. I started researching some options: Yoga, Gym, Boxing, Pilates, Kickboxing, Private trainer and more. It's mind boggling but more importantly it's wallet emptying.. I was trying to find a place where I could workout whenever I wanted and not have to wait for a machine or make an appointment for a class but also not break the bank. 9Round is not only the best value compared to all the other options, but you can go anytime on any day within their hours (5am - 11pm). There are trainers there to help and guide you during specific times and there are also tv's at every station to show you how to do the workouts. There are 9 stations - and you will spend 3 minutes at each station w/a 30 second break between stations. The trainers are super helpful to show you how to do the workouts correctly, work on your form and even give you a mental push if you need/want it. The best part is you can go as often as you want, and the workouts change daily so you won't get bored of the same routine. It's very clean there and have yet to run into some of "those gym people" who are wearing makeup or cologne and want to be seen. Quick tip - if you want workout with fewer people or without a trainer on site, you can go during hours when they are not available. I usually workout between 1-3pm and it's a much quieter time.
